Goal: £10k for 10 charities in £10 months

We are taking on a new family challenge to raise awareness & funds for charities close to our hearts & those we love. We hope to inspire others to help, donate & connect with these amazing charities & the people they support.

UPDATE: Total amount raised (online and offline) = £12,317!!! (including gift aid and matched funding paid directly to charities.) Thank you to all our supporters.

Here are some of the things we got up to:-

For our first fundraiser, we held a plant sale for the local school PTA from plants we grew from seed and propagation, raising a total of £700. The "seeds" for this wider challenge were sown from the success of this sale. The PTA used the fund to buy much needed equipment for the classrooms, learning materials for the school and organises fun events that the children would otherwise miss out on. We also organised stalls at their school fairs to raise money.

Our second charity was Samaritans. As a previous Samaritan volunteer I know how important their work is to support those who feel they have no-one else to talk to. We took part in a Samarathon (walking 26.2 miles as a family) in July to raise much needed funds for this cause.

Our third charity was RNIB Talking Books - like us, my Mum was an avid reader but sadly suffered from a rare form of dementia (Posterior Cortical Atrophy) which affected her ability to read (her eyesight was unaffected but her brain could no longer process writing) so she relied on audio books. We raised £1,500 to produce a new children's talking book and give those who need it access to the wonderful world of books, via book sales and readathons.

Our forth charity is Tia Greyhound rescue - we will be organising Dog First Aid courses and raffles/auctions of all things dog related to raise money for this charity which supports abandoned, mistreated and unwanted greyhounds.

Our fifth charity was World Land Trust - we are passionate about saving the world's rainforests and are delighted to add WLT, advocated by David Attenborough, to our list. We held cookalongs to raise money for this charity thanks to amazing support from Ian at https://foodfrom4.com

Our sixth charity was RSPB as chosen by Grandma and Grandad who are huge fans of birds, wildlife and UK conservation. We held painting parties and sold hand painted cards, created by Barbara Hems.

Our seventh charity was Babies in Buscot Support, the Baby Special Care Unit at Royal Berks, in honour of a close family friend. We are delighted to support this charity which saves so many babies lives. We held a Halloween Spooktacular Event and raised over £1k for this great charity.

Our eighth charity was ASD family help who provide much needed support, advice and activities for those with autism and other learning difficulties. This charity was also nominated by a close family friend. We sourced a sponsored bungee jump for members of this charity to raise funds.

Our ninth charity was Macmillan Cancer Support, a vital charity providing reassurance, guidance and support to those diagnosed with cancer. This charity has supported our friends and family through their cancer journeys so we know just how amazing they are. We held a number of stalls at local fairs and organised a Diwali event to raise money for this cause.

Our tenth charity was Wokingham in Need - we helped raise money for the community via auctions and helping at a number of their events.

We also had a number of online auctions and lots of other events during the 10 months. We had so much fun together, loved inspiring our friends and family, and were proud to have helped these amazing charities in some small way.
